John James warned that growing pressure on Soho's pubs and clubs to host more quiet nights threatens to kill an international city, leaving London lagging behind rivals Paris, New York and Milan.
With more noise complaints than ever, beloved local venues are frequently finding themselves at the mercy of councils' licence hearings... a great pub in Clerkenwell, the Sekforde, called on Londoners to help keep it open after noise complaints.
